My Buying Guides on Portable Inflatable Paint Booth
What I Look for First
When I shop for a portable inflatable paint booth, the first thing I check is the size. I want enough room to move around comfortably, especially if I’m spraying larger items like car parts, furniture, or multiple panels at once. I also pay close attention to the booth’s internal height and width, because I do not want to feel cramped while working.
Material Quality and Durability
I always look at the material thickness and overall build quality. A good inflatable paint booth should be made from strong, tear-resistant, and puncture-resistant material. I prefer booths with reinforced seams and heavy-duty zippers because those details usually mean better durability and less air leakage over time.
Air Filtration and Ventilation
For me, proper airflow is one of the most important features. I want a booth with reliable intake and exhaust filtration so overspray and fumes are managed well. Good ventilation helps me get a cleaner finish and keeps the work area safer. I also check whether the filters are easy to replace, since that saves me time and hassle later.
Portability and Setup Time
Since I’m choosing a portable booth, I want something that is easy to transport and quick to set up. I look for a design that inflates fast and deflates without much effort. A lightweight carrying bag or compact storage size is also a big plus for me, especially if I need to move it between locations.
Size and Workspace Layout
I think about what I plan to paint most often. If I’m doing small projects, a compact booth may be enough. But if I want to paint motorcycles, car panels, or larger furniture, I need more space. I also like booths with a practical layout, such as a front door, side access, and enough room to place lighting or drying racks inside.
Lighting Compatibility
Good lighting matters a lot in my painting work. I check whether the booth has transparent or light-friendly panels, or enough space to add my own lighting setup. Clear visibility helps me spot uneven coverage, dust, or missed areas before the paint dries.
Noise Level
I do not ignore the blower noise. Since the booth depends on continuous airflow, I prefer a unit that runs as quietly as possible. A quieter blower makes the work environment more comfortable, especially if I spend long hours painting.
Ease of Maintenance
I like equipment that is easy to clean and maintain. A booth with a smooth interior surface is much easier for me to wipe down after use. I also check whether replacement parts, filters, and repair kits are available. That gives me peace of mind if something wears out.
Safety Features
Safety is a big priority for me. I look for flame-retardant materials, secure zippers, stable anchoring options, and proper ventilation. If I’m using solvents or spray paints, I want a booth that helps reduce exposure and keeps the workspace as controlled as possible.
Budget and Value
I do not always go for the cheapest option. Instead, I compare the price with the booth’s size, material quality, airflow system, and included accessories. In my experience, a slightly higher upfront cost is often worth it if the booth lasts longer and performs better.
